Cannot Modify Header Information - Headers Already Sent Php.ini
That's where you had to look for premature output. But when I transfered my code to my Linux server, which uses PHP version 5.3.2, I got the error message. *shakes fists* Sendilrr I have corrected this error. I think you have missed an ending script tag after the unFreezeScreen definition. Preceding error messages If another PHP statement or expression causes a warning message or notice being printeded out, that also counts as premature output. Check This Out
I love you! Thanks again. Rajnikant12345 Thanks buddy, it worked and I learned a new thing . Place form processing code atop scripts. http://stackoverflow.com/questions/8028957/how-to-fix-headers-already-sent-error-in-php
Problem solved by putting ob_start(); before session_start(); thanks Fr for the suggestion (couldn't find any white space) Thanks to this article I've kept on top of the headers already sent error But in the end, your php.ini edit worked like a charm! :) You are awesome! Most programmer and console editors however do: There it's easy to recognize the problem early on. Fechar Saiba mais View this message in English Você está visualizando o YouTube em Português (Brasil). É possível alterar essa preferência abaixo.
http://www.tech-recipes.com Quinn McHenry Your database query may not be returning a valid result. God, I wish i did it straight away, havens, I spent smth like 2 hrs to solve it! Nothing else worked and I tried it all! sandeep thanks it helped i made the common culprit error Reuben Thank you so much!
in the file you listed, there's some output occurring in the header.php file, intended or not. What is the temperature of the brakes after a typical landing? I encountered this issue when I installed a php script within my functions.php & I was pulling my hair out - then I took a long deep breath and decided to I'm pretty sure I just had that UTF 8 BOM thing....WHAT THE HELL IS THAT THING!
Log in or register to post comments Hi, sfcamil commented August 21, 2015 at 8:55am Hi, Same problem after update to drupal-7.39: Warning: Cannot modify header information - headers already sent I think I did have the ending tag "}" if that is what you meant. Christian > THANK YOU!!!! Something like that anyway, I’m new to PHPSo the fix was to change the virtual to a include:(you might not need the ‘../’ part)Save it and hope for the best!This fixed
It doesn't work with UTF-8. check my blog This is the error that I'm getting… Warning: Cannot modify header information - headers already sent by (output started at /home/rdrewniak1/webfiles/dmit271/assignments/final_project/admin/includes/admin-header.php:110) in /home/rdrewniak1/webfiles/dmit271/assignments/final_project/admin/products.php on line 92 So, if I'm understanding this Why?Because already a new line is generated. It should fix it.
They should start with the bytes 3F 3C. his comment is here File encoding haven't crossed my mind. A warning outputted by php, if the display_errors php.ini property is set. This warning message is produced by PHP if a program attempts to send an additional HTTP header after the separator (and hence all the headers) has already been sent.
But it won't compensate multiple newlines or tabs or spaces shifted into such gaps. Remove it. See the comments below as other people have figured out other specific solutions. this contact form If you’re curious, here’s what an HTTP response could look like: Everything before the is the header.
Correction utilities There are also automated tools to examine and rewrite text files (sed/awk or recode). The session functionality obviously also depends on free disk space and other php.ini settings, etc.) Further links Google provides a lengthy list of similar discussions. The output_buffering= setting nevertheless can help.
If header.php is actually supposed to produce some output, then you should place the login conditional before you include header.php, otherwise you'll just need to go in and eliminate any output
kod lasak 1.473 visualizações 14:48 How To Solve URL Not Found Error In Wordpress - Duração: 3:39. It denominates the source of previous output. It can likewise be engaged with a call to ob_start(); atop the invocation script. It was the whitespace issue - I spent hours trying to find an answer to this.
Join them; it only takes a minute: Sign up How to fix “Headers already sent” error in PHP up vote 841 down vote favorite 485 When running my script, I am Erased ?> and works like a charm. Often by inserting spam links into page footers etc. navigate here What could be the reason for this?
For certain if you don't see any characters before the error, you're looking for whitespace. –Jason Mar 14 '12 at 18:37 Thanks for the replies. Go to: Global Configuration/System, disable web services, re-enable web services(if that doesn't work)set session handler to none,(apply)then change back to database(apply):) Enjoy Retrieved from "https://docs.joomla.org/index.php?title=Cannot_modify_header_information_-_headers_already_sent&oldid=39608" Category: Development This page was last Chris Thanks! It is possible to define metric spaces from pure topological concepts without the need to define a distance function?
However, while output buffering avoids the issues, you should really determine why your application outputs an HTTP body before the HTTP header. Problems with "headers already sent" can also be caused by having a blank line at the end of *.inc files. By blakemathews10 on 17 Apr, 2011 Thanks!! If that's the start of the page then that.
Everything works fine. What if "a_important_file.php" is this: ----------This is the end of the an_important_file------------------- This will rich Oh, and what didn't work for me was: 1. One of my client's came up to me with this problem in one of his old code!
I've got a line with echo before the header, and got the same warning - Cannot modify header information - headers already sent. Please correct me if I am confused or the steps are not mentioned right. Please leave us a comment below! By Dev on 19 Oct, 2010 ob_start(); Awesome!
Thx all. Brilliant. So, the functions setcookie() and setrawcookie() would try to modify the headers.